- 博客(9)
- 资源 (2)
- 收藏
- 关注
转载 SpringBoot整合Shiro实现登录认证和权限授权
Shiro是一个功能强大、灵活的,开源的安全框架,主要可以帮助我们解决程序开发中认证和权限等问题。基于拦截器做的权限系统,权限控制的粒度有限,为了方便各种各样的常用的权限管理需求的实现,我们有必要使用比较好的安全框架。早期Spring security 作为一个比较完善的安全框架比较火,但是Springsecurity学习成本比较高,于是就出现了shiro安全框架,学习成本降低了很多,而且基本的功能也比较完善。Shiro的架构1、Subject:主题。被验证的对象,一般指的当前用户对象。但是不仅
2020-05-28 16:02:31 991
原创 SpringBoot封装RedisTemplate实现Redis数据缓存
Redis是一个开源的内存数据结构存储,用作数据库,缓存和消息代理。以(key,value)的形式存储数据的数据库,是当前互联网世界最为流行的 NoSQL(Not Only SQL)数据库。主要用Redis实现缓存数据的存储,可以设置过期时间。适合高频读写、临时存储的数据。Redis 可以存储键与5种不同数据结构类型之间的映射,这5种数据结构类型分别为String(字符串)、List(列表)、Set(集合)、Hash(散列)和 Zset(有序集合)。结构类型结构存储的值结构的读写能力
2020-05-27 17:47:37 497
原创 Redis的安装、启动和在Intellij IDEA中的使用
Redis的安装、运行1.点击这里下载>Redis-x64-3.2.100.zip下载解压后打开文件夹,内容如下:2.编辑redis.windows.conf文件,修改两处找到bind 127.0.0.1将其注释即#bind 127.0.0.1设置密码requirepass 123456保存并关闭文件3.在此文件夹下【Redis-x64-3.2.100】打开cmd窗口输入redis-server.exe redis.windows.conf启动Redis,显示以下界面在idea
2020-05-26 22:01:58 15384 24
转载 SpringBoot集成JWT实现token令牌验证
JWT,英文全称JSON Web Token:JSON网络令牌。为了在网络应用环境间传递声明而制定的一种基于JSON的开放标准(RFC 7519)。这个规范允许我们使用JWT在客户端和服务端之间传递安全可靠的信息。JWT是一个轻便的安全跨平台传输格式,定义了一个紧凑自包含的方式,用于通信双方之间作为 JSON 对象安全地传递信息。此信息可以通过数字签名进行验证和信任。紧凑:这个字符串简洁,数据量小,传输速度快,能通过URL参数、HTTP请求提交的数据以及HTTP Header的方式进行传递。自包含
2020-05-26 16:37:00 752 2
原创 REST和RESTful以及它们之间的区别
REST,英文全称Representational State Transfer(表述性状态转移),是一组架构约束条件和原则(注意,REST是设计风格而不是标准)。满足这些约束条件和原则的应用程序或设计就是RESTful。可以降低开发的复杂性,提高系统的可伸缩性。Representation(表现层),资源的信息载体形式。它可以是文本、XML、JSON或者是一个二进制文件。它的表现形式应该在HTTP请求的头信息中用Accept和Content-Type字段指定描述。State Transfer(状态转移
2020-05-22 12:28:08 1080
原创 URI,URL,URN以及三者的区别
URI,英文全称Uniform Resource Identifier(统一资源标识符)URL,英文全称Uniform Resource Locator(统一资源定位符)URN,英文全称Uniform Resource Name(统一资源命名)
2020-05-22 10:40:38 344
原创 Java获取当前时间String类型和Date类型
Date date = new Date(); S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); //获取当前时间为String类型 String time_string = sdf.format(date); System.out.println("获取当前时间为String类型:"+time_string); //获取当前时间为Date类型 D..
2020-05-13 16:16:10 8331 1
转载 SpringBoot中注入RedisTemplate实例异常解决之org.springframework.beans.factory.NoSuchBeanDefinitionException
Error starting ApplicationContext. To display the conditions report re-run your application with 'debug' enabled.2020-05-12 11:15:00.385 [main] ERROR org.springframework.boot.SpringApplication - Application run failedorg.springframework.beans.factory.Uns
2020-05-12 11:39:43 2756
SecureCRT_FX8.7.zip
2021-10-16
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人